Classic Deep Fried Marshmallows


  • Author: Sarah White
  • Total Time: 15 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ings 1x
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

A simple and delicious recipe for deep-fried marshmallows that are crispy on the outside and gooey on the inside. Perfect for parties or as a fun dessert!


Ingredients

Scale
    • 20 Jumbo Marshmallows
    • 1 1/2 cups Pancake Mix
    • 1 Large Egg
    • 1 cup Milk
    • 2 teaspoons Vegetable Oil (plus more for frying)
    • Whipped Cream (for serving)
    • Chocolate Syrup (for serving)
    • Sprinkles (for serving)

Instructions

  • Prepare Batter: In a mixing bowl, combine pancake mix, egg, milk, and 2 teaspoons of vegetable oil. Whisk until smooth and no lumps remain.
  • Heat Oil: Heat vegetable oil in a deep pot to 350°F (175°C).
  • Coat Marshmallows: Dip each marshmallow into the batter, ensuring it’s fully coated.
  • Fry Marshmallows: Carefully drop marshmallows into the hot oil, frying a few at a time until golden brown, about 30-60 seconds.
  • Drain: Remove with a slotted spoon and place on a paper towel-lined plate to drain excess oil.
  • Serve: Serve warm, topped with whipped cream, chocolate syrup, and sprinkles.

Notes

Ensure oil is at the right temperature to avoid greasy marshmallows.

Maintenance Tips for Perfect Deep-Fried Marshmallows

Maintain Your Oil for Best Results

  • The quality of your oil significantly impacts the outcome of your deep-fried marshmallows. Always use fresh oil to prevent any unwanted flavors from previous frying sessions. Maintaining the oil temperature at about 350°F (175°C) is crucial for optimal frying. This method ensures the outside becomes crisp while the inside stays delightfully gooey. To achieve this, use a thermometer and adjust the heat as needed.

Control Your Frying Temperature

  • Maintaining a consistent oil temperature is key when making fried marshmallows. Overheated oil may cause the marshmallows to char on the outside before they cook through. Conversely, if the oil is too cool, the batter will soak up too much oil, leading to a greasy finish. To avoid these issues, fry in small batches and allow the oil to return to the correct temperature between batches.

Proper Storage for Leftovers

  • If you have leftover deep-fried marshmallows, store them properly to maintain their deliciousness. Store them in a tightly sealed container with paper towels at the base to soak up any leftover oil. While they’re best fresh, reheating in an oven or air fryer can revive their crunch. Avoid microwaving, as it tends to make the marshmallows soggy and unappealing.

Dietary Adaptations and Healthier Alternatives for Deep-Fried Marshmallows

Gluten-Free Deep-Fried Marshmallows

  • For those avoiding gluten, fried marshmallows are still on the menu with one simple adjustment. Opt for a gluten-free pancake mix rather than the traditional kind. Verify that all additional ingredients, such as marshmallows and any toppings, are certified gluten-free. This way, you can still achieve the same delicious, crispy texture without any gluten.

Vegan-Friendly Options

  • Vegans can enjoy this treat by substituting with suitable vegan products. Replace the egg in the batter with a flaxseed or chia seed egg. Blend one tablespoon of ground flaxseeds or chia seeds with three tablespoons of water and allow it to settle for a few minutes to thicken. Swap out dairy milk for a plant-based version, like almond or oat milk. Finally, opt for vegan marshmallows, which are free of gelatin and perfect for this recipe.

Lower Fat Alternatives

  • For a lighter version of fried marshmallows, consider baking them instead of frying. Prepare the marshmallows as usual, but instead of frying, bake them in a preheated oven at 375°F (190°C) for about 10 minutes or until golden and crispy. Consider using an air fryer to achieve a crispy finish with less oil involved.  This technique lessens the fat content while preserving the delicious, indulgent flavor.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Deep-Fried Marshmallows

What is the Best Oil for Deep-Frying Marshmallows?

  • To fry deep-fried marshmallows effectively, choose an oil with a high smoke point, like vegetable, canola, or peanut oil. These oils ensure that the marshmallows cook evenly without burning. Additionally, they have a neutral flavor, which allows the sweet taste of the marshmallows to shine through without being overpowered by the oil’s flavor.

Can I Prepare the Batter in Advance?

  • Absolutely, you can mix up the batter for fried marshmallows beforehand. Just combine the ingredients as directed and refrigerate the batter in a sealed container for up to 24 hours. This is ideal for saving time on the day you plan to cook. Ensure you stir the batter well before using to guarantee a smooth consistency for frying.

How Do I Prevent Marshmallows from Sticking Together While Frying?

  • To avoid deep-fried marshmallows sticking together in the oil, make sure to fry them in small batches. Avoid overcrowding the fryer as it may lead to marshmallows sticking together and cooking unevenly. Instead, fry a few at a time, ensuring each marshmallow has enough space to move around freely. Proper spacing helps them achieve a uniform golden-brown crust.

Is It Possible to Freeze Deep-Fried Marshmallows?

  • Freezing fried marshmallows is not recommended, as they tend to lose their crispy texture after being frozen and thawed. While best enjoyed fresh, if you have extras, store them at room temperature in a sealed container and consume within a couple of days. Warming them up in an oven or air fryer can rejuvenate their crispy texture.
